Waldwick is a city in Bergen County , New Jersey , United States . In the census of 2000 had a total population of 9,622 was recorded.

Demographics
As of the 2000 census, there are 9,622 people, 3,428 households and 2,677 families in the city. The population density is 1,786.1 inhabitants per km 2 . 92.68% of the population are White, 0.59% African American , 0.04% Native American , 4.52% Asian , 0.00% Pacific Islander , 1.31% Other Ethnicity, and 0.85% Mixed Race . 5.31% are Latinos of any race.
Of the 3,428 households, 36.3% have children under the age of 18. 67.5% of them are married couples living together, 7.8% are single mothers, 21.9% are not families, 18.7% are single households and 10.6% are people over 65. The average household size is 2 , 81, the average family size 3.22.
25.5% of the population are under 18 years old, 5.3% between 18 and 24, 31.5% between 25 and 44, 22.5% between 45 and 64, 15.2% older than 65. The average age is 38 years. The ratio of women to men is 100: 94.8, for people older than 18 the ratio is 100: 92.0.
The median income for a household in the city is $ 75,532 , and the median income for a family is $ 82,208. Males have a median income of $ 60,671 versus $ 37,145 for females. The per capita income for the city is $ 30,733. 2.1% of the population and 1.3% of families live below the poverty line, of which 1.7% are children or adolescents younger than 18 years and 3.0% of people are older than 65.
